
FLAGSTAFF — Coconino County Treasurer Sarah Benatar had the honor of placing wreaths at Pearl Harbor on Sunday following the National Association of Counties’ (NACo) annual Western Interstate Region (WIR Conference (in Maui County, Hawai’i).
Benatar attended the 40th Anniversary of the USS Missouri’s Cold War Recommissioning where she met with veterans and active military personnel to celebrate their service and achievements. Alongside Jackson County Legislator’s Manuel Abarca IV and Venessa Huskey, she laid wreaths to honor both the USS Missouri and the USS Arizona.
“At the USS Arizona Memorial, I was reminded that service, sacrifice and stewardship are not just ideals, they are responsibilities we carry forward,” Benatar said. “On behalf of Coconino County and my county colleagues through NACo, it was a profound honor to place a wreath in tribute to those who gave everything and to reaffirm our commitment to never forget their legacy.”
